Gophers Split Saturday Slate
2/14/2026 6:28:00 PM | Softball
GAME ONE
LAS CRUCES, NM – The Minnesota Golden Gophers struggled on Saturday, falling to the Oklahoma Sooners by a final score of 12-2.
Natalie Susa (0-2) got the ball to start for Minnesota (3-5) and took the loss.
At the plate, the Golden Gophers were paced by Cassie Johnson, who went 1-for-1 on the day with a home run, a walk and an RBI. Tara Wolocko compiled a standout performance at the plate as well, going 1-for-2 with a home run and an RBI.
HOW IT HAPPENED
The Golden Gophers were trailing 1-0 in the first inning when they first put runs on the board. Minnesota scored two runs on solo shots from Wolocko and Johnson. The Golden Gophers were unable to hold the lead, as Oklahoma scored 11 times over the remaining four innings to grab the 12-2 win.
GAME NOTES
» Minnesota's highest scoring inning was the first, when it pushed two runs across.
» Minnesota pitchers faced 35 Oklahoma hitters in the game, allowing eight ground balls and four fly balls while striking out three.
» Johnson led the Golden Gophers at the plate, going 1 for 1 with a home run and an RBI.
GAME TWO
LAS CRUCES, NM – Tara Wolocko put together a stellar showing at the plate Saturday, hitting two homers to help propel the Minnesota Golden Gophers over the New Mexico State Aggies 11-4.
Macy Richardson (1-0) started in the circle and picked up the win for Minnesota (3-5). The right-hander went four innings, giving up four runs, all of them earned, on seven hits, allowing two walks and striking out one. Sydney Schwartz also made an impact in the circle for the Golden Gophers, throwing three shutout innings while allowing no hits, with one walk and four strikeouts.
Wolocko went 2-for-4 at the plate, supplementing her two home runs with two RBIs. Jae Cosgriff added to Wolocko's awesome power-hitting performance by going 2 for 4 with a double, a home run and five RBIs. Scarlett Kuhn also chipped in for the Golden Gophers, going 4-for-4 with a double, a home run and two RBIs.
HOW IT HAPPENED
The Golden Gophers got the scoring started early, putting two runs on the board in the top of the first inning.
The Aggies then tied the ballgame at three before the Golden Gophers came back to reclaim their advantage in the fourth inning. Minnesota pushed across a run on Cosgriff's one-out RBI double, which brought the Golden Gophers lead to 4-3.
Minnesota held New Mexico State without a run before building their lead to 6-3 the following inning. The Golden Gophers added two to their tally on Kuhn's two-run homer.
The Aggies fought back, closing the gap to 6-4 until Minnesota added some insurance in the seventh. The Golden Gophers left the yard two times in the inning on the way to scoring five runs, bringing the score to 11-4 in favor of Minnesota. The score remained 11-4 for the rest of the game, as the Golden Gophers coasted to the win.
